excel怎么锁定一个单元格不让修改
在Excel中,锁定一个单元格不让修改可以通过以下几种方法:使用“保护工作表”功能、设置“单元格格式”中的锁定属性、使用密码保护工作表。 其中,最常用且最有效的方法是通过“保护工作表”功能来实现。这不仅可以防止特定单元格被修改,还可以保护整个工作表中的其他重要数据。以下是具体操作步骤。
一、保护工作表功能
使用Excel的“保护工作表”功能是锁定单元格最常见的方法。通过这种方法,你可以选择性地锁定某些单元格,而允许其他单元格进行编辑。
1.1 选择需要锁定的单元格
首先,选择你希望锁定的单元格或区域。你可以按住Ctrl键来选择多个不连续的单元格,或者拖动鼠标来选择一个连续的区域。
1.2 设置单元格格式
右键点击已选择的单元格,然后选择“设置单元格格式”选项。在弹出的对话框中,转到“保护”选项卡,确保“锁定”复选框被选中。
1.3 保护工作表
接下来,点击“审阅”选项卡,然后选择“保护工作表”。在弹出的对话框中,你可以设置密码以增加安全性。输入密码后,点击“确定”即可完成操作。
1.4 保护选项
在保护工作表的对话框中,你可以选择允许用户进行的操作。例如,允许选定锁定单元格或选择未锁定单元格。根据你的需求进行选择,然后点击“确定”。
二、设置单元格格式中的锁定属性
除了保护整个工作表,你还可以通过设置单元格的锁定属性来实现单元格不被修改。
2.1 取消默认锁定
Excel默认情况下所有单元格都是锁定的,但在未保护工作表时,这种锁定是无效的。你需要首先取消所有单元格的锁定。
2.2 选择特定单元格
选择你希望锁定的特定单元格或区域,右键点击选择“设置单元格格式”。在“保护”选项卡中,选中“锁定”复选框。
2.3 保护工作表
最后,按照前述方法保护工作表,这样设置了锁定属性的单元格就会被保护,无法编辑。
三、使用密码保护工作表
为了增加安全性,你还可以在保护工作表时设置密码。这将确保只有知道密码的人才能取消保护并编辑单元格。
3.1 设置密码
在保护工作表的对话框中,输入你希望设置的密码。建议使用复杂的密码以增加安全性。输入密码后,系统会要求你再次确认密码。
3.2 取消保护
当你需要编辑被锁定的单元格时,只需取消保护工作表。点击“审阅”选项卡,然后选择“取消保护工作表”,输入密码即可。
四、保护整个工作簿
有时,你可能需要保护整个工作簿而不仅仅是单个工作表。Excel也提供了这种功能。
4.1 保护工作簿结构
在“审阅”选项卡中,选择“保护工作簿”,然后设置密码。这将防止用户添加、删除或重命名工作表。
4.2 设置密码
在弹出的对话框中输入密码,然后再次确认。这样,整个工作簿的结构将被保护,用户无法进行结构性修改。
五、使用VBA代码实现锁定
对于高级用户,使用VBA代码可以提供更多的灵活性和控制。你可以编写宏来锁定特定的单元格或区域。
5.1 打开VBA编辑器
按下Alt + F11键打开VBA编辑器,然后插入一个新的模块。
5.2 编写代码
在模块中输入以下代码:
Sub LockCells()
'选择需要锁定的单元格
Range("A1").Locked = True
'保护工作表
ActiveSheet.Protect Password:="yourpassword"
End Sub
5.3 运行宏
关闭VBA编辑器,回到Excel工作表,然后按下Alt + F8键运行宏。这样,单元格A1将被锁定,且需要密码才能取消保护。
六、使用第三方工具
有时,内置的Excel功能可能无法满足所有需求。此时,可以考虑使用第三方工具来增强保护功能。
6.1 插件安装
许多第三方工具提供了额外的保护功能。你可以通过Excel的插件管理器来安装这些工具。
6.2 使用工具
根据工具的用户手册,设置并使用保护功能。大多数工具提供了比Excel内置功能更为复杂的保护选项。
七、常见问题及解决方案
在锁定单元格的过程中,可能会遇到一些常见问题。以下是一些常见问题及其解决方案。
7.1 无法取消保护
如果你忘记了密码,可以尝试一些密码恢复工具。这些工具可以帮助你恢复忘记的密码。
7.2 锁定后无法编辑其他单元格
确保在保护工作表时,选择了“选择未锁定单元格”选项。这样,你仍然可以编辑未锁定的单元格。
7.3 锁定属性未生效
确保在设置锁定属性后,已经保护了工作表。仅设置锁定属性而不保护工作表是无效的。
通过以上方法,你可以有效地锁定Excel中的单元格,防止未经授权的修改。无论是通过内置功能还是使用第三方工具,都可以实现这一目标。选择最适合你的方法,并根据需求进行设置,以确保数据的安全性和完整性。
相关问答FAQs:
1. 如何在Excel中锁定单元格以防止修改?
问题: 我想在Excel中锁定某个单元格,以防止其他人对其进行修改。该怎么做?
回答: 要锁定一个单元格,首先需要设置保护工作表的选项。在Excel中,您可以通过以下步骤来实现:
选择您要锁定的单元格或单元格范围。
在“开始”选项卡中,点击“格式”。
在“保护工作表”下拉菜单中,选择“保护单元格”选项。
在弹出的对话框中,确保“锁定”复选框处于选中状态。
点击“确定”来保存更改。
最后,在“审阅”选项卡中,点击“保护工作表”按钮,设置密码并选择保护选项,以确保只有授权人员可以修改。
2. 如何在Excel中设置只读单元格?
问题: 我想在Excel中设置某个单元格为只读,其他人只能查看而不能修改。应该怎么做?
回答: 要设置只读单元格,您可以按照以下步骤进行操作:
选择您要设置为只读的单元格或单元格范围。
在“开始”选项卡中,点击“格式”。
在“保护工作表”下拉菜单中,选择“保护单元格”选项。
在弹出的对话框中,确保“锁定”复选框处于未选中状态。
点击“确定”来保存更改。
最后,在“审阅”选项卡中,点击“保护工作表”按钮,设置密码并选择保护选项,以确保只有授权人员可以修改。
3. 如何在Excel中设置部分单元格可编辑,其他单元格只读?
问题: 我想在Excel中设置某些单元格可以编辑,而其他单元格则只能查看而不能修改。有什么办法可以做到?
回答: 在Excel中,您可以使用以下方法将部分单元格设置为可编辑,其他单元格设置为只读:
选择您要设置为只读的单元格或单元格范围。
在“开始”选项卡中,点击“格式”。
在“保护工作表”下拉菜单中,选择“保护单元格”选项。
在弹出的对话框中,确保“锁定”复选框处于未选中状态。
点击“确定”来保存更改。
选择您要设置为可编辑的单元格或单元格范围。
在“开始”选项卡中,点击“格式”。
在“保护工作表”下拉菜单中,选择“保护单元格”选项。
在弹出的对话框中,确保“锁定”复选框处于选中状态。
点击“确定”来保存更改。
最后,在“审阅”选项卡中,点击“保护工作表”按钮,设置密码并选择保护选项,以确保只有授权人员可以修改。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4162166